Over 220 to the wheels with conservative pulley and no intercooling. I'm including an intercooler and you could easily add it to the system. I don't know how this kit isn't desirable since its the only kit that allows you to keep your AC, looks pretty factory and neat. Bleu had this running in his car reliably. With someone who really went all out you could make some serious power. This kit comes with everything you need, the piggy back, chip, pulleys, everything. It isn't just a blower with a manifold. Its basically turn key except for your tuning. A kit like this from any of the current players would sell for 5k.
